The RTX 4080 is one-half of the Lovelace duo that Nvidia unveiled on September 20. The GPU comes with 9,728 CUDA cores, 16 GB of VRAM with a base clock of 2.21 GHz and a boost clock of 2.51 GHz. 3DCenter has now compiled launch review results of the GPU to provide a holistic view of the performance and price value offered by the board.https://www.notebookcheck.net/RTX-4080-review-roundup-suggests-33-faster-4K-performance-39-better-perf-W-and-31-worse-perf-price-for-the-GPU-vs-RTX-3080.669765.0.html
